Soderling breezes into round of 16 (AP)

Robin Soderling has advanced to the round of 16 at the U.S. Open with a 6-2, 6-3, 6-3 victory over Thiemo de Bakker of the Netherlands. The fifth-seeded Soderling, twice a runner-up at the French Open, needed only 1 hour, 42 minutes at blustery Flushing Meadows on Saturday to defeat the 48th-ranked de Bakker.

Jankovic upset by Kanepi at US Open (AP)

Fourth-seeded Jelena Jankovic was upset by 31st-seeded Kaia Kanepi 6-2, 7-6 (1) in the third round of the U.S. Open on Saturday. Jankovic struggled with the wind at Arthur Ashe Stadium on Saturday, at one point hitting a serve so badly the ball flew straight up into the air. The Serb had 41 unforced errors and just 13 winners.

Cubs' Silva to start after heart problem (AP)

Carlos Silva is scheduled to start Tuesday for the Chicago Cubs against Houston after missing more than a month because of a heart problem. He takes the spot of Tom Gorzelanny, who will miss at least one turn in the rotation after being hit in the left hand by a line drive against Pittsburgh on Wednesday.

Ramirez has early single at Fenway (AP)

Manny Ramirez has made a quick contribution on his return to Fenway Park with the Chicago White Sox. The former Boston Red Sox slugger singled to right field in the second inning Saturday, sending Paul Konerko to third with no outs. Konerko then scored the first run of the game when A.J. Pierzynski grounded into a double play against Clay Buchholz.
